Emission factor summary

Emissions generated by the activity within the product supply chain as described in ecoinvent v3.8. Ethyl acetate' is an organic substance with a CAS no. : 000141-78-6. It is called 'ethyl acetate' under IUPAC naming and its molecular formula is: C4H8O2. It is liquid under normal conditions of temperature and pressure with a sweetish odour. The substance is modelled as a pure substance. On a consumer level, is used in the following products: cosmetics and personal care products, adhesives and sealants, coating products, fillers, putties, plasters, modelling clay, finger paints, inks and toners, plant protection products, perfumes and fragrances, air care products, biocides (e.g. disinfectants, pest control products), textile treatment products and dyes, washing & cleaning products and leather treatment products. There is no publicly available information about the consumption of this substance on industrial sites. The cut-off classification is allocatable product. The activity type is ordinary transforming activity. The reference product amount is 1.
